There are many different types of berries, including strawberries, blueberries, blackberries, raspberries, cranberries, and gooseberries. Some berries, like strawberries and blueberries, are grown commercially and are widely available in grocery stores, while others, like elderberries and black currants, are less common.

Berries are used in a variety of ways, including in desserts, smoothies, jams and jellies, syrups, and as a garnish. They are also popular as a snack, either on their own or mixed with other fruits. In addition to their culinary uses, some berries, such as cranberries and elderberries, have been used for their medicinal properties for centuries.
